Florence “Nikki” Murphy, 102, of Clinton, passed away Tuesday, August 2, 2016 at the Alverno.

Funeral Services will be 11:00am, Friday, August 5, 2016 at Immanuel Lutheran Church – Camanche. Burial will be in the Rose Hill Cemetery. Serving as pallbearers will be her grandchildren and great-grandchildren. Serving as honorary pallbearers will be James Haring, Larry Cornelius, Melvin Goffinet, Eugene Vining, and Stan Dierks. Visitation will be from 9:30am to the service time Friday at the church. The Camanche Chapel Snell-Zornig Funeral Homes & Crematory is in charge of arrangements.

Florence was born on August 26, 1913 in Stanwood, Iowa, the daughter of Alfred and Hertha (Klahn) Meier. She married Kenneth Murphy on January 10, 1933 in Dixon, Illinois, he died November 8, 1994.

Florence was a 1931 graduate of Lyons High School. A homemaker, she was a member of Immanuel Lutheran Church in Camanche, the Izaak Walton League, the American Legion Auxiliary, the Clinton County Historical Society and the Clinton Women’s Club.

Florence is survived by her daughter: Roxy Baker of Sun City, Arizona, two sons: Alan (Bonnie) Murphy of Camanche, and Ronald (Sheryl) Murphy of East Moline, Illinois; 9 grandchildren, 15 great-grandchildren, and numerous great-great & great-great-great grandchildren and a niece Kay Dierks of Clinton. She was preceded in death by her husband, a son, and a brother: Sylvan Meier.

Memorials can be made to Immanuel Lutheran Church – Camanche.
